Following the completion of the first network design for a district-wide everyday and leisure cycling concept, this design can now be cycled, evaluated and a signage plan drawn up by the commissioned green-solutions office. This will serve as the basis for the creation of the cycle path concept for Altmühlfranken.
As part of the regional management funding project to create a district-wide everyday and leisure cycle route concept, an initial draft network was created following discussions with municipalities, towns and markets at the beginning of the year. After further coordination with the specialist authorities, the draft network can now be used by the commissioned specialist office Green Solutions.

The cycle route inspection will continue into the summer months, during which the cycle routes and gaps in the network planned by the mayors and employees of the building authorities and tourism departments will be inspected, evaluated and provided with a signage plan. This inspection is carried out by bicycle to ensure that cyclists always have a clear view.
